An Aluminum Alloys Planner is the technical authority responsible for creating and controlling heat treatment instructions that ensure aluminum products are processed in compliance with customer requirements, aerospace industry standards, and quality system requirements. The Planner requires extensive knowledge of aluminum metallurgy, heat treatment processes, pyrometry, quality systems, testing requirements, and documentation controls, along with the ability to translate complex requirements into clear operational instructions that operators can execute consistently and safely. The Aluminum Alloys Planner is a mid-level heat treatment professional responsible for translating customer, engineering, and specification requirements into detailed, compliant work instructions for the heat treatment of aluminum alloys. The Planner bridges the gap between operators and process owners by ensuring all processing, testing, equipment, quality, and documentation requirements are clearly defined and executed in accordance with aerospace standards and customer requirements.
